Covenant Players Gallery

These are figures done of characters from the plays of Charles M. Tanner, as portayed by members of the Covenant Players international drama ministry (of which I am a member).

Sarah Bernhardt

The Divine Sarah has been played by Suzanne Goettl and Sarah Kitch.  Here, I've amalgamated the two with the historical Sarah.

Lt. Wedgewood and the Badger

Charles Tanner commissioned this pivotal moment of his play, The Messenger - and it still adorns his workspace at home.

Claudia Procula

This was more a study in how to work out the clothing.  The character is the wife of Pontius Pilate.

The Boleyn

Sue Blough in the role of Anne Boleyn.

Gavrilo Prinzip

The part of the man who touched off WWI has been played by a number of people.  This is based on Polish CPer Darek Kawulok.

Simone

One of many figures I have done of Suzanne Goettl.  This one is Simone from the French Underground Series.  Yes - she is holding a gun.  That's for dramatic effect.

 

The Empress

Compare these two versions of the Empress , of the Pirate Series.  The first is based on Sharon Johnson's portrayal, the second, made a year later, is based on Jody Bader.

These are further figures from Charles M. Tanner's French Underground Series

Maj. General Wolfgang Kramer

Although this was not based on Schy Gleason, he is probably the one most associated with the role.

Countess Yvonne de Valierre

Pam Cowser provided the inspiration for this figure of the flamboyant, danger-seeking Countess

M. Carbonnier

This is a detail from a larger photograph taken of Bill Coburn, when Marian gave him the figure she had commissioned me to make.

 
Transit Gloria

A CPer requested this version of the perennial CP scene from the perennial CP play (complete with folding chairs and table)  -  Bob Sinclair counting off the Ten Commandments.  Recognize the fellow playing Bob?
